Few drivers in Formula 1 have had the privilege of driving for Red Bull. Even fewer have done so in their maiden campaign. That is how highly rated Alexander Albon Ansusinha was in the eyes of the Austrian team. However, Alex Albon’s Red Bull career did not pan out in the way he had anticipated. Now driving for Williams Racing in 2023, he is slowly proving himself worthy of being a mainstay in the sport.

Born in 1996, Alex Albon is a Thai-British professional racer but competes under the flag of Thailand, where his maternal family has roots. He is only the second Thai driver ever to race in F1 and the only Asian to score two podium finishes in the series.

Alex Albon Net Worth

Alex Albon has a net worth of $3 million in 2023. The majority of this is down to his salary derived from racing in Formula 1. A portion of Albon’s net worth is also contributed by his endorsement deals. Albon’s net worth has grown steadily since he joined the topmost tier of motorsport. In 2021 and 2022, his net worth was reported to be about $1 million. This is despite the fact that Albon was only a reserve driver for Red Bull and Alpha Tauri in 2021.

Alex Albon Salary

Alex Albon is on a $3 million contract with Williams for the 2023 season. He is signed on till the end of 2024. In 2022, Albon earned $2 million racing in his first year for the team. In the year before that, he had been demoted to a reserve-cum-test driver role at Red Bull and Alpha Tauri, making $650,000. Albon earned close to $2.5 million in 2020 when he took part in all races for Red Bull.

Alex Albon Endorsements

According to his official website, Albon is a brand ambassador for Monsoon Valley Vineyards and promotes the Thailand-based company’s non-alcoholic beverages. He had signed a deal with Japanese watchmakers Casio in 2019, which was only his rookie F1 season with Toro Rosso. His popularity with Thai brands is further indicated by his endorsements with companies like PTT Lubricants and Moose Craft Cider.

Albon is currently the most experienced driver representing Asia on the grid. This makes him one of the most recognizable and marketable personalities, especially with brands from the Eastern Hemisphere. He is reported to have made investments in TMRW Sports, which has also inked deals with several other F1 drivers. There is no further information available about Albon’s investments.

Alex Albon House

Albon has a family home in Milton Keynes, England which is where he grew up. He also has a house in the glamorous principality of Monaco. This is not a surprise as several Formula 1 drivers reside there. Albon once even admitted that saving on taxes in Monaco is one of the best things about it. He also likes Monte Carlo for the consistent weather year-round, the quiet surroundings and its good restaurants.

Alex Albon Cars

Alex Albon has a collection of cars that would make any automobile fan green with envy. It includes a Honda Civic Type R, a Mercedes GLE, an Aston Martin DB11 and an Aston Martin Vantage. The two Aston Martins are definitely the crown jewels in Albon’s garage with the DB 11 worth $220,000 and the Vantage costing about $150,000. Both cars can achieve top speeds in excess of 186 miles per hour (300 km/h).

Alex Albon Charity

Alex Albon is an ambassador for the Iceman Charity, which is based in his home country of Thailand. In early 2022, he visited an orphanage in Wat Sakraeo and worked to raise funds for essential work there. He even auctioned a special helmet at the Singapore Grand Prix that year for the same cause. The combined efforts raised close to $120,000. Albon has been personally inspired by Formula One legends like Lewis Hamilton and Sebastian Vettel to do his bit for society.
